How is the timing of gene expression controlled in the lytic cycle?
What will be an ideal response?
Ans: Regulatory genes function in a cascade to control gene expression. The first genes are expressed using the host's transcription apparatus. One of the newly transcribed genes encodes a protein required for transcription of the next set of genes. The next transition requires a gene product produced by these genes.
